Comic illustrations depict Botswana

The duo of Zwelithini Masuku and Tshepo Kraai, both 22, have been working on a number of comic illustration books that have not yet been published for the past five years.  Masuku said the passionate duo’s work has an indigenous flavour that showcases the life and day-to-day events that are taking place in the country.

“Most of our work is local content that shows the diversity of Botswana, which is educating and entertaining,” he said. The comic illustrations that the duo has worked on is in different forms, which have the same style as that of the Marvel Comics that are famous for the Batman and Superman comic books, which have been sold worldwide.

Kraai who is the art director mentioned that the current comic books are for different age groups,   “We have a super hero comic book, which is still under works that is for young children.  The other one called Skirts is for young adults as it touches mainly on HIV/AIDS and youth.”

She further said their main target readers are teenagers as they are planning on distributing the books in secondary schools. Kraai said that passion for art and creativity drove them to focus on comic illustration, “A number of artists are still trapped in the traditional form of art which mainly focuses on portraits and the same old designs.”  She is willing to help upcoming artists with comic illustration skills.

The duo said that lack of funds is a huge blow for developing their work as they are failing to acquire proper resources and equipment.

Masuku mentioned that most of the equipment that they use such as copic markers and certain fine liners are only available outside the country.

“We are currently looking for sponsors that can help us acquire printers, a digital working space and also to distribute our books,” he said. 

He added that the lack of funds is the one reason that has stopped them from publish books that they have written. The two artists who did not attend art school for their craft believe that they have a natural talent. 

Masuku is a Psychology and Sociology student while Kraai is a Fashion and Design graduate.

Kraai believes that the comic illustration competition in Botswana is very low and if they get help from sponsors they can create a comic foundation in the country that can pave way for upcoming artists.

South African soccer comic book Super Strikers is one of the few comic books that is well distributed and appreciated in the country.
